India is making significant strides in renewable energy with its latest gigawatt-scale project, guided by Prime Minister Narendra Modi's vision for a sustainable future. This ambitious initiative is set to enhance India's energy independence and reduce its carbon footprint, placing the nation at the forefront of global renewable energy advancements. The project underscores India's commitment to the Paris Agreement and is a pivotal step towards its goal of achieving 450 gigawatts of renewable energy by 2030.

  • 🌏 Location: The project is primarily located in the western state of Gujarat, renowned for its solar and wind potential.
  • 🔆 Scope: The venture includes solar, wind, and hybrid energy systems, bolstering India's renewable capacity.
  • 📅 Timeline: Construction began in early 2023, with the first phase expected to be operational by 2025.
  • 👥 Key Figures: Minister of New and Renewable Energy, R.K. Singh, highlights the project as a revolutionary move in India's energy sector.
  • 💰 Investment: The project has attracted significant domestic and international investments, reflecting global confidence in India's renewable energy potential.
  • 🚀 Impact: This initiative will create numerous jobs, boost local economies, and contribute to a cleaner environment.
